Requirements

  • 5+ years of experience in project management, including facility project management
  • 5+ years of experience with project management software, including Microsoft Project, PowerPoint, Excel, and Word
  • 5+ years of experience with AutoCAD and concept planning, and Statement of Work development
  • Experience with master planning electrical distribution, generators, and Automatic Transfer Switch operation
  • Knowledge of project design or construction efforts, including schedule, funding, and day-to-day project oversight
  • Ability to manage and evaluate construction contractor performance
  • Ability to ensure integration of all systems, including information technology, telephone, security, electric, HVAC, and plumbing
  • Ability to prepare a contractor performance report (CPR) upon contract close-out
  • TS/SCI clearance with a polygraph
  • Bachelor's degree in an Engineering Field

Responsibilities

  • Analyze, formulate, and recommend facility standards and design and space criteria and usage through space utilization studies and forecasts for clients in national security.
  • Provide quality control and technical oversight on facilities projects
  • Review project drawing and design specifications and identify any issues
  • Lead analyses and solution development for facility planning and management for challenging organizations.
  • Perform complex activities for the control and management of cost, schedule, risk, and resource optimization.
  • Prepare and review facilities estimates and site proposals for client review as to cost and feasibility.
  • Assist with budget planning and the strategic development of a site master plan
  • Advise clients in developing plans and programs responsive to present and anticipated portfolio, facility, or individual space requirements.
  • Recommend planning, design, and construction standards and milestones
